When choosing a front door color, you must take into account the structure and exterior design of your home. Although it is not essential to match the exterior color of the house or its interior style, you should choose a door according to the color of your facade and driveway. You can prevent the colors of your home from colliding by turning your front door into a contrasting hue to give your home a visual appeal. The choice of front door colors which contrast with the exterior colors of your home draws attention to your door and makes the main entrance the main focus. Traditional houses usually have rich, deep-colored front doors. They require bold, deep door colors, including navy, dark red, brown and black, while contemporary homes opt for bold, bright front doors. A red brick house with a front door that's olive-green; for example, will accentuate its color and a pale yellow home with a purple door will look charming.

Red is a very popular front door color because it adds a daring touch to a home exterior.
Red is also associated with passionate people. It is the perfect color for anyone who wants to match their door with their bright and charming personality. In other parts of the world, people paint their front doors red as it is considered a lucky color.
Red is recommended as the best color for doors facing south by the traditional Feng Shui. A front door that's bright-red denotes strength and life, and is associated withy strong, positive people.
Yellow is a cheerful, vibrant color that exudes welcome.
The owner of a yellow front door can be regarded as curious, confident, fun-loving and humorous. Yellow entry doors are cheerful and inviting, and they belong to the houses of people who are happy and optimistic. The vibrant splash of yellow color reflects a homeowner with an exuberant personality.
Feng Shui dictates that yellow hues are great for southern doors and they embody uniqueness and cheerfulness.
Although it may appear strange to some, orange is a surprisingly common front door color.
Orange implies that you are kind, approachable, and not afraid to make a bold statement. This color could indicate that the homeowners are outgoing, sociable, and entertaining. Feng Shui:
Orange and fiery colors are suitable for doors to the south. It is also widely used as an interior color in restaurants to encourage customers to feel hungry, so you can be sure that if you walk into a home with an orange front door, you'll be well fed!
A blue door will add an element of elegance and class to your home that will not go unnoticed.
Blue is an unusual door tone that looks great for coastal and traditional homes. Navy blue is usually the front door color choice for blue and grey houses. Many properties also have deep blue doors that look good surrounded by white. The color blue, which ranges from light to dark, represents peace and quiet, signaling to visitors that they are entering a safe haven.
Blue is a good color for northern doors because it represents trustworthiness, safety, and organization. A blue door has a soothing quality about it. This hue represents trust and calmness in Feng Shui design. A blue front door will boldly display your positivity to others if you're emotionally balanced, have a positive nature, and believe everything is possible.
White has long been linked with purity and peace, and it creates the sense that you and your home value tranquility, cleanliness, hospitability, and generosity.
If you lean toward the purity of white, you may be someone who appreciates the spa-like beauty of simplicity and serenity and prefers everything to be orderly.
White is the Feng Shui color for west-facing doors, and it looks beautiful painted on wooden doors. The color white is associated with sterility, cleanliness, and simplicity.
Black is a popular color choice that gives your home’s facade a modern, serious and luxurious look.
Black doors can be chosen by people with a strong sense of style. Together with the color of the exterior, they can help to give your home an unexpected and quirky touch. The beauty of using black as your front door color is that it provides a timeless look, helping you stay in style with various trends. If you already have a white, beige or light grey home, a black door provides much-needed contrast and gives you the freedom to add colorful decorative touches.
Black is recommended for northern doors and it symbolizes order and control. People with black doors suggest that they value consistency, elegance and reticence.
A green front door can be found in the homes of those who love nature, their community and their family.
Green indicates that the proprietors are likely to be caring, peaceful, and community-minded. A green front door symbolizes prosperity, health, and security and looks great in traditional homes. A rich, dark green tend to appeal to people who are kind with a confident demeanor. A brighter, bolder green might be the best choice if you enjoy adventure and the great outdoors. This color represents affluence and richness, but it also conveys a sense of calm and tranquility
Earthy tones like green are great for east facing doors. Peace, harmony, growth, and rejuvenation are all symbols of this earth-friendly color.
A deep, darker purple represents wealth and expensive taste.
If you paint your front door purple, it will give off a refined vibe. If you choose a bold color like violet, it may indicate that you're a bit boisterous or a risk-taker. Owners may love taking large risks and are willing to try new things in life. It can imply that you're an outgoing person who is a free thinker and has big aspirations, and doesn't care what others think.
Purple is an unusual color for a front door but can be a good choice for doors facing north. It symbolizes huge ambitions and possibilities.
Natural, brown wooden doors go well with the down-to-earth, hand-crafted look of traditional craftsman houses.
Brown front doors bring a positive energy to the house .This natural organic color reflects homeowners who are warm and dependable. Natural wood or wooden-looking doors can give your home a rich, earthier, rustic appearance. It indicates that you are level-headed, sensible, and down-to-earth.
For east-facing doors that have earth tones, brown is recommended. They embody warmth, peacefulness and comfort.
